About this property
Cabin in the Pines, Prescott, AZ
Darling, spotless, furnished cabin in the forest only 2 miles from the town center and 3 miles from the local hospital. Perfect for visiting nurses/professionals. Location is quiet, near hiking, perfect for biking and lazy days. Area is quiet and scenic. Perfect for visiting nurses or professionals. Beautiful, furnished cabin. you'll be staying in a charming log cabin in the forest but only 2 miles from downtown galleries, shopping and great food! Hike Thumb Butte, only a stone's throw away. The Court House offers lots of special events and cool shade. Enjoy the cool nights with warm, pleasant days! 3miles from hospital. Take a walk through the park like setting or just relax and enjoy the sounds of birds , watch the deer or take a nice bike ride up to Thumb Butte, one of Prescott's favorite areas. Guest access. Parking available on the driveway and there is a space in front. The cabin is only two miles from the main town with galleries, great food and fun activities in the Courtyard!
